Brian Eric Caine

About Brian Eric Caine

Brian Eric Caine is a lawyer practicing debt & lending agreements, bankruptcy and creditors' rights, mortgage foreclosure. Brian received a B.S. degree from University of Pittsburgh in 1995, and has been licensed for 26 years. Brian practices at Parker McCay P.A. in Mount Laurel, NJ.
